Here's how to do long-exposure images on an iPhone: In your iPhone Photos app, open any Live Photo, and tap the Live button. Select Long Exposure. Daily one-minute tips sent straight to your inbox. The photo will convert to a Long Exposure shot.

Use Live Photos on your iPhone to create long exposure-style shots without manual shutter control. Night mode allows up to 30-second exposures in low light, but you can't use it in daylight. Consider third-party camera apps to take longer exposures up to 30 seconds.
